A 58-year-old female asked:

Hub had a ct scan that found a 7 cm cyst in his liver read as benign and one in his kidney. ultrasound showed complex renal cyst. related? age 69

Unrelated: Usually those 2 cysts are unrelated, however if the renal cyst is complex then a follow dedicated ct or ultrasound of the kidney should be done in 3-6 months to confirm stability.

Usually unrelated: Liver and kidney cysts are common. A complex cyst anywhere needs to be properly worked up, usually with short interval (3-6 month) followup, although comparing the ct to the us in this case may provide more information about how to proceed.
